The Talent Development Project Manager will work directly with their Talent Development team, HR Business Partners and the businesses to develop and execute comprehensive learning and leadership development solutions. The primary responsibilities are to ensure Blackstone professionals have the right skills and development plans to be successful both internally and with clients, partner with the business to identify and harness the potential of top talent, support the firm's growth by helping Blackstone maintain consistent firm culture and quality of talent, implement programs that strengthen the leadership capability and development of Blackstone professionals. This role will focus on providing support to firm-wide programs and training for specific groups, such as various investment groups and Technology Innovations group (BXTI).
